On the back or bottom of the router there should be a small hole. You will need to fit something into that hole to press the reset button that is there, such as a paperclip. With the router plugged in, press and hold the reset button for 30 seconds. After releasing the button, wait...

2.For these models, we could seeWPS/RESETbutton on the rear panel/the Front Panel. To use WPS function, please push the button for less than 5 seconds, and then the WPS LED will flash; to reset the router, please push the button for at least 10 seconds. ...
